    Understanding the AP World History: Modern Curriculum

    The AP World History: Modern course covers the period from roughly 1750 to the present day. This timeframe encompasses pivotal moments in human history, including the Enlightenment, the French and Industrial Revolutions, the rise of nationalism and imperialism, World Wars I and II, the Cold War, decolonization, and globalization. The sheer breadth of this material necessitates a structured and efficient study approach. Quizlet, with its versatile learning tools, can be a powerful ally in your quest for mastery.

    Creating Effective Quizlet Sets for AP World History: Modern

    The key to successful Quizlet usage lies in creating well-structured and effective sets. Don't just dump all the information into a single massive set. Instead, break down the material into manageable chunks based on specific topics or time periods. Here's a suggested approach:

    • Topic-Based Sets: Create separate Quizlet sets for key topics like the Enlightenment, the Industrial Revolution, World War I, the Cold War, and decolonization. This allows for focused study and helps avoid information overload.

    • Chronological Sets: Consider creating sets organized chronologically, covering specific decades or centuries. This approach helps establish a clear timeline of events and their interconnectedness.

    • Thematic Sets: Develop sets focusing on overarching themes such as revolutions, imperialism, nationalism, and globalization. This will help you understand the recurring patterns and underlying causes of historical events.

    • Key Term Sets: Develop sets dedicated to key terms, concepts, and individuals crucial to understanding each topic. Ensure accurate definitions and provide context for better comprehension.

    • Image-Based Sets: Incorporate images, maps, and charts where applicable. Visual aids significantly improve retention, particularly for geographical contexts and political boundaries.

    Beyond Basic Flashcards: Utilizing Quizlet's Advanced Features

    Quizlet offers more than just basic flashcards. Leveraging its advanced features significantly enhances your learning experience:

    • Learn Mode: This mode presents terms and definitions in a spaced repetition system, optimizing recall and reducing reliance on rote memorization.

    • Write Mode: Test your knowledge by writing down the answers, forcing active recall and strengthening memory consolidation.

    • Test Mode: Choose between multiple-choice, matching, and true/false tests to assess your understanding of the material. Regular testing is crucial for identifying weak areas and strengthening knowledge.

    • Scatter Mode: Drag-and-drop terms and definitions to their correct matches, encouraging active learning and improving retention.

    • Spaced Repetition System (SRS): Quizlet's algorithm automatically adjusts the frequency of review based on your performance. This ensures you revisit challenging concepts more frequently, leading to improved long-term retention.

    Integrating Quizlet into Your Overall Study Plan

    Quizlet shouldn't be your only study tool. It’s most effective when combined with other learning methods:

    • Textbook Readings: Supplement your Quizlet studies with thorough textbook readings and additional research. Quizlet helps reinforce what you've learned, but the initial understanding comes from the primary source material.

    • Class Notes: Regularly review your class notes and integrate key points into your Quizlet sets. This strengthens your understanding of the instructor’s emphasis and clarifies any areas of confusion.

    • Practice Exams: Use past AP World History: Modern exams and practice questions to simulate the testing environment. Identify your weak areas and refocus your Quizlet study accordingly.

    • Group Study: Collaborate with classmates to create and review Quizlet sets. Explaining concepts to others helps reinforce your own understanding and allows for collaborative learning.

    Addressing Common Challenges & FAQs

    Q: How do I avoid Quizlet becoming just rote memorization?

    A: Focus on understanding the why behind the facts. Add context to your flashcards. Don't just memorize dates; understand the significance of those dates within the larger historical narrative. Use the various study modes offered by Quizlet to force active recall and application of knowledge.

    Q: Is Quizlet enough to prepare for the AP World History: Modern exam?

    A: No, Quizlet is a supplementary tool. It's most effective when combined with textbook readings, class notes, and practice exams. It helps reinforce learning but doesn't replace a comprehensive understanding of the material.

    Q: How much time should I spend on Quizlet each day?

    A: This depends on your individual learning style and the amount of material you need to cover. Start with shorter study sessions (30-60 minutes) and gradually increase the time as needed. Consistency is more important than the amount of time spent in a single sitting.

    Q: What if I don't understand a concept after using Quizlet?

    A: Consult your textbook, class notes, or seek help from your teacher or a tutor. Quizlet is a tool to reinforce understanding, not replace it. Don't hesitate to seek clarification when needed.
